Course Content

• Introduction to Cognitive Interviewing Techniques and Principles
• Memory and Cognitive Processes: Improving Recall Through Interviewing
• Question Formulation and Sequencing for Optimal Information Retrieval
• Rapport Building and Communication Skills in Cognitive Interviews
• Cognitive Interviewing in Criminal Investigations: Case Studies and Best Practices
• Advanced Techniques in Cognitive Interviewing: Dealing with Challenging Witnesses
• Ethical Considerations and Legal Ramifications of Cognitive Interviewing
• Evaluating the Effectiveness of Cognitive Interviews: Data Analysis and Interpretation
• Cognitive Interviewing for Vulnerable Witnesses: Special Considerations and Adaptations
